This powerful reportage work documents the final stages of the decline of a traditional industry in the former East German town of Gruben. Now better known for its right wing movement and the death of an Algerian worker in 2000, the town's hat making industry goes back nearly 180 years and in 1922 employed 20,000 people. These images, produced with a large format camera, show the last factory with its ten employees just before its closure. Although documenting industrial processes in a cavernous decaying old building, these rich, almost lyrical, images address the loss of craftsmanship and tradition.
